Description
Owing to the SuperFlex Design, the Fronius Symo is the perfect answer to irregularly shaped or multi-oriented roofs. The standard interface to the internet via WLAN or Ethernet and the ease of integration of third-party components make the Fronius Symo one of the most communicative inverters on the market. Furthermore, the meter interface permits dynamic feed-in management and a clear visualisation of the consumption overview.

Technical Specifications Input Data
- Max. input current (Idc max) – 33.0 A / 27.0 A.
- Max. array short circuit current – 51
- Min. input voltage (Udc min) – 200 V.
- Feed-in start voltage (Udc start) – 200 V.
- Nominal input voltage (Udc,r) – 600 V.
- Max. input voltage (Udc max) – 1000 V.
- MPP voltage range (Umpp min – Umpp max) – 420 V – 800 V.
- Number of MPP trackers – 2.
- Number of DC connections – 3 + 3.
Output Data
- AC nominal output (Pac,r) – 20000 W / 20.0 kW.
- Max. output power – 20000 VA.
- Max. output current (Iac max) – 31.9 A.
- Grid connection (voltage range) – 3-NPE 400 V / 230 V or 3~NPE 380 V / 220 V (+20 % / -30 %)
- Frequency (frequency range) – 50 Hz / 60 Hz (45 – 65 Hz).
- Total harmonic distortion – < 2 %.
- Power factor (cos φac,r) – 0 – 1 ind. / cap.
General Data
- Dimensions (height x width x depth) – 725 x 510 x 224 mm.
- Weight – 43.4 kg.
- Degree of protection – IP 66.
- Protection class – 1.
- Overvoltage category (DC / AC) – 2 / 3.
- Night-time consumption – < 1 W.
- Inverter concept – Transformerless.
- Cooling – Regulated air cooling.
- Installation – Indoor and outdoor installation.
- Ambient temperature range – -25 – >60 °C.
- Permitted humidity – 0 to 100 %.
- Max. altitude – 2,000 m / 3,400 m (unrestricted / restricted voltage range).
- DC connection technology – 6x DC+ and 6x DC- Screw terminals 2.5 – 16 mm².
- AC connection technology – 6x DC+ and 6x DC- Screw terminals 2.5 – 16 mm².
- Mains connection technology – 5 pole AC screw terminals 2.5 – 16 mm².
- Certificates and compliance with standards – ÖVE / ÖNORM E 8001-4-712, DIN V VDE 0126-1-1/A1, VDE AR N 4105, IEC 62109-1/-2, IEC 62116, IEC 61727, AS 3100, AS 4777-2, AS 4777-3, CER 06-190, G83/2, UNE 206007-1, SI 4777, CEI 0-21.
Efficiency
- Max. efficiency – 98.1 %.
- European efficiency (ηEU) – 97.9 %.
- MPP adaptation efficiency – > 99.9 %.
Protective Devices
- DC insulation measurement – Yes.
- Overload behaviour – Operating point shift. Power limitation.
- DC disconnector – Yes.
Interfaces
- WLAN / Ethernet LAN – Fronius Solar.web, Modbus TCP SunSpec, Fronius Solar API (JSON).
- 6 inputs and 4 digital in/out – Interface to ripple control receiver.
- USB (A socket) – Datalogging, inverter update via USB flash drive.
- 2x RS422 (RJ45 socket) – Fronius Solar Net.
- Signalling output – Energy management (potential-free relay output).
- Datalogger and Webserver – Included.
- External input – S0-Meter Interface / Input for overvoltage protection.
- RS485 – Modbus RTU SunSpec or meter connection.
